Special Issue Information
Dear Colleagues,
Critical patient care is characterized by high clinical complexity, the need for continuous monitoring, and rapid decision-making in the face of potentially life-threatening conditions. In this scenario, advances in health technologies and the development of innovative interventions have expanded possibilities to improve care, optimize work processes, strengthen patient safety, and improve clinical outcomes.
This Special Issue aims to gather scientific evidence on the role of emerging technologies and innovative interventions in clinical practice, teaching, and research in critical care. Studies addressing the development, validation, implementation, and evaluation of technologies such as integrative and complementary health practices, artificial intelligence, digital health, mobile health (mHealth), virtual reality (VR), augmented reality (AR), mixed reality (MR), extended reality (XR), and other technological solutions applied to the care of critically ill patients are welcome. Research on pharmacological and non-pharmacological interventions aimed at managing signs and symptoms, patient safety, supporting clinical decision-making, rehabilitation, humanizing care, and healthcare professional training is also encouraged.
Original research articles, methodological studies, observational studies, clinical trials, implementation research, systematic reviews, meta-analyses, scoping reviews, umbrella reviews, conceptual analyses, and reflection articles will be considered.
